The Connecticut marketplace, also called the “exchange,” is Access Health CT. It provides health plan shopping and enrollment services through its website and call center, plus in-person help during the annual open enrollment period. En español | Most residents of Connecticut are eligible to buy health insurance through Access Health CT, the state’s Affordable Care Act (ACA) marketplace, during open enrollment from Nov. 1, 2023, through Jan. 15, 2024. Aetna’s roots stretch all the way back to 1853, when the company was formed In Hartford, Connecticut. Nearly a century later in 1951, Aetna offered its first major medical coverage policies.Cigna Corporation was formed from two other companies: The Insurance Company of North America (INA), founded in 1792, and the Connecticut General Life Insurance Company, founded in 1865. 92 Today the company has a global footprint in more than 30 countries around the world. 93 Cigna insures 17 million medical customers …To identify the best health insurance companies for the 2024 coverage year, we evaluated nine major health insurance companies for 40 criteria that span cost, plan quality and customer ...Commercial auto insurance.
